Victor E. Sell

Victor E. Sell, 89, of Royal Center passed away peacefully at 7:25 p.m., Tuesday, October 5, 2021 at Franciscan Hospital in Lafayette.

Born on April 22, 1932 in Logansport, he was the son of the late Walter C. and Ruth B. (Roller) Sell.

He was a 1950 Royal Center High School graduate.

Victor also served his country in the U.S. Army where he was stationed in Korea.

On June 5, 1955 he married Rowena “Ellen” Layer, she survives.

He was a lifelong farmer and was a member of Shiloh Christian Church, Gideons, Lucerne Lions, VFW, American Legion and Indiana Farm Bureau.
